Jerry is in the Army and his best friend is killed in front of him by a roadside bomb. For several days afterward, Jerry's think

ing becomes delusional and he holds a pose as if he were shooting his rifle. After about a week, he returns to normal. The most likely diagnosis is __________ disorder.

Answer:

The most likely diagnosis is <u>brief psychotic</u> disorder.

Explanation:

A traumatic event such as a tragic loss or a violent accident can trigger an state of alteration and disconnection from reality. Brief reactive psychosis is a rare psychological disorder in which periods of psychotic behavior occur suddenly and of short duration. These psychotic behaviors can range from hallucinations, delusions or confusion among others. Sometimes psychotic symptoms appear suddenly in response to a situation of great stress, although the symptoms can be very intense, recovery occurs within a few days, in other words, normally the symptoms of reactive psychosis resolve on their own in a period of no more than a month.

Theory demand and it's implications to the housing market​
Free_Kalibri [48]

Answer:

The primary factor influencing demand for housing is the price of housing. By the law of demand, as price decreases, the quantity of housing demanded increases. The demand for housing also depends on the wealth of households, their current income, and interest rates.

Popular sovereignty, also called squatter sovereignty, in U.S. history, a controversial political doctrine according to which the people of federal territories should decide for themselves whether their territories would enter the Union as free or slave states. Its enemies, especially in New England, called it “squatter sovereignty.
